Facts about Rourkela [1]:
- The name Rour kela in the local tribal language of Sadri means "Our Village"
 - Fourth largest city of Odisha after Bhubaneswar, Cuttack and Berhampur
 - Rourkela is the industrial capital of Odisha.
 - RSP - One of the largest steel plants of SAIL is situated here.
 - It also has one of the National Institute of Technology (NIT) of the country.
 - City is surrounded by a range of hills and encircled by rivers.
 - Any weather season is extreme here.
